ANSYS二次开发:Python解析ansys fluent结果文件

🍺相关文章汇总如下🍺:

  1. 🎈ANSYS二次开发:APDL开发入门准备🎈
  2. 🎈ANSYS二次开发:后处理使用APDL命令流解析结果文件🎈
  3. 🎈ANSYS二次开发:Python解析ANSYS结果文件(PyAnsys库)🎈
  4. 🎈ANSYS二次开发:Python和ANSYS进行交互操作(PyAnsys库,PyDPF)🎈
  5. 🎈ANSYS二次开发:Python解析ANSYS FLUENT结果文件🎈

1、fluent简介

Ansys Fluent是业界领先的流体仿真软件,以其先进的物理建模功能和行业领先的精度而闻名。

官网地址:
https://www.ansys.com/zh-cn/products/fluids/ansys-fluent

在这里插入图片描述
Ansys Fluent ,是国际上比较流行的商用CFD软件包,在美国的市场占有率为60%,凡是和流体、热传递和化学反应等有关的工业均可使用。它具有丰富的物理模型、先进的数值方法和强大的前后处理功能,在航空航天、汽车设计、石油天然气和涡轮机设计等方面都有着广泛的应用。

Ansys Fluent ,用来模拟从不可压缩到高度可压缩范围内的复杂流动。与FLUENT配合最好的标准网格软件是ICEM。FLUENT系列软件包括通用的CFD软件FLUENT、POLYFLOW、FIDAP,工程设计软件FloWizard、FLUENT for CATIAV5,TGrid、G/Turbo,CFD教学软件FlowLab,面向特定专业应用的ICEPAK、AIRPAK、MIXSIM软件等。

Ansys Fluent ,可为您提供更多时间进行创新和优化产品性能。相信您的仿真结果,我们的软件已在各种应用中进行了广泛验证。借助Ansys Fluent,您可以在可自定义的直观空间中创建高级物理模型并分析各种流体现象。

在这里插入图片描述

What’s New:Ansys Fluent继续朝着更高效、更可持续的计算流体动力学(CFD)仿真迈进。此更新包括 GPU 技术和开源可访问性的重大进步,以提高工作效率并缩短仿真时间。

  • (1)释放 GPU 的强大功能
    使用多 GPU 求解器可大幅缩短仿真求解时间和总功耗,结果显示 6 个高端 GPU ≈ 2,000 个 CPU。现在支持瞬态流,包括尺度分辨仿真 (SRS)、非共形接口 (NCI) 和移动参考系 (MRF)。
    在这里插入图片描述

  • (2)Ansys Fluent的公开接口
    使用 PyFluent(通过 Python 对 Fluent 的开源访问)实现流程自动化、构建自定义工作流程、制作自定义解决方案等。
    在这里插入图片描述

  • (3)从生产到消费的氢气模拟
    使用新的质子交换膜 (PEM) 模型 (BETA) 精确模拟通过电解生成的绿色氢气,并使用经过验证的氢气和氢气混合物燃烧模型模拟氢气消耗。
    在这里插入图片描述

  • (4)高效结构化网格划分
    使用 Fluent 水密几何工作流程中的新多区域功能高效生成结构化网格。多区域操作还包括扫描网格、分离区域和分割圆柱体。
    在这里插入图片描述

  • (5)改进的高超音速空气热力学
    准确预测由于具有部分催化壁边界条件的放热复合反应而向高超声速飞行器表面的传热。这解释了原子的重组和改进的物种混合物组成的预测。
    在这里插入图片描述

  • (6)准确的电池膨胀
    通过耦合 Fluent 的电池和固有流固耦合 (FSI) 模型,准确预测充电期间由于电化学、压力和膨胀相关材料特性而导致的电池膨胀。
    在这里插入图片描述

2、fluent文件格式

2.1 常见格式

在这里插入图片描述
ANSYS Fluent会涉及多种类型的文件:

  • ANSYS Fluent输入的文件类型包括grid、case、data、profile、 Scheme以及 journal文件
  • ANSYS Fluent输出的文件类型包括 case、data、 profile、 journal以及 transcript等。
  • ANSYS Fluent还可以保存当前窗口的布局以及保存图形窗口的副本。

ANSYS Fluent用到的主要文件类型:

  • grid(网格文件),.msh,记录网格数据信息。MSH是GAMBIT处理后输出给FLUENT计算的文件。Gambit可识别的文件后缀为.dbs,而要将Gambit中建立的网格模型调入Fluent使用,则需要将其输出为.msh文件 (file/export)。FLUENT读取MSH文件后可以保存为CAS文件。
  • case(项目文件),.cas,记录物理数据、区域定义、网格信息。利用Fluent Meshing将cas文件读入,然后输出为msh文件,利用SpaceClaim读取msh文件再转化为几何文件。Case(案例文件),扩展名为.cas,包括网格,边界条件,解的参数,用户界面和图形环境的信息。这是Fluent中的基本文件之一,是核心文件。将网格导入Fluent,便可选择File菜单中的相关命令生成该文件。
  • data(数据文件),.dat,记录每个网格数据信息,以及收敛的历史记录(残差值)。DAT文件包含对应CAS文件计算的结果。Data(数据文件),扩展名为.dat,包含每个网格单元的流场值以及收敛的历史纪录(残差值),该文件时Fluent中的基本文件之一,用户可随时调用该文件查看计算结果。
  • profile(边界信总文件),用户指定扩展名,用于指定边界区域上的流动条件。在proflie文件中经常使用的变量名称包括time(时间)、u或v_x(x方向速度)、v或v_y(y方向速度)、w或v_z(z方向速度)、omega_x(x方向角速度)、omega_y&#
评论 25
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值